什麼是分面導航? SEO要考慮的主要因素
已發表: 2022-03-31如果您曾經在網上購物,那麼您肯定會遇到多面導航——您可能只是沒有意識到!
按價格排序、按大小過濾和按顏色排序都是分面導航(也稱為分面搜索,有時也稱為引導式導航)的絕佳示例。

簡而言之,分面導航是一種幫助訪問者導航和個性化頁面以找到他們正在尋找的確切產品的方法。 分面導航創建的頁面還可以幫助人們搜索特定的長尾查詢,在搜索結果中找到他們正在尋找的確切產品。
儘管分面搜索對用戶有用,但如果您不小心,它可能會給 SEO 帶來一些嚴重的問題。 讓我們看一些分面導航示例,看看會出現哪些類型的問題。

哪些類型的網站有分面導航?
分面導航已成為電子商務網站的標誌,但零售商並不是唯一使用它的人。
例如:
- 出版商 經常使用分面導航來幫助訪問者按內容類型(日期、主題等)過濾
- 工作列表網站等分類網站使用分面導航來幫助訪問者按位置等內容進行過濾。
- 所有類型的大型網站都經常使用分面導航。 一般來說,網站越大,就越有可能有某種分面導航來改善用戶體驗。
所有這些網站都容易出現分面導航經常導致的 SEO 陷阱,所以讓我們來探討一下這些常見問題是什麼。
分面導航會導致哪些 SEO 問題?
據谷歌稱,分面導航通常對搜索不友好。
為什麼? 因為構面會創建同一個 URL 的多個版本。 (我們稍後會回到它是如何工作的。)
這會導致四個主要的 SEO 問題:
- 重複內容,因為您的網站上存在同一頁面的多個版本。 如果有的話,許多方面不會改變頁面內容。 例如,按價格對產品進行排序的選項可以創建多個頁面,其中包含相同的產品,只是順序不同。
- 稀釋的鏈接權益,因為內部鏈接將分佈在多個 URL 上。 而不是鏈接到的頁面的一個變體,可能有數百個。 這很糟糕,因為不是一個頁面獲得所有鏈接的好處,而是其中一些鏈接重複。
- 抓取浪費,因為谷歌會花時間在重複的頁面上,並且可能會錯過/沒有時間來抓取您有價值的頁面。
- 抓取陷阱,因為在許多情況下,分面導航可以創建幾乎無窮無盡的核心 URL 組合。 這稱為爬網陷阱,因為機器人實際上會在爬取這些 URL 時被困。
一些 SEO 可能會爭辯說,分面導航是一種輕鬆創建針對具有小而特定搜索意圖的長尾搜索查詢的頁面的方法。 但是,您應該始終首先驗證該主題的搜索意圖是否確實存在。
請記住,僅僅因為您可以創建頁面並不意味著您應該!
分面導航創建的 SEO 問題示例
讓我們看一個產品頁面少於 200,000 個的電子商務網站的示例。
當 Botify 按照與該網站在 robots.txt 中為 Google 設置的相同規則進行爬網時,我們發現有超過 5 億個頁面可訪問。
請記住,這個電子商務網站的產品不到 200,000 種,但搜索引擎機器人可訪問的頁面數卻超過 5 億!

原因? 該站點的分面導航為同一個 URL 創建了無數種組合,不幸的是,這種情況並不少見。
但是,“同一個 URL 的多個版本”是什麼意思?
例如,假設我們在一個銷售計算機的電子商務網站上,我們正在查看“監視器”類別頁面。
該頁面的主要 URL 可能是:
https://example.com/monitors/
現在假設有屏幕尺寸、分辨率和連接性的過濾器,我選擇我希望看到具有 HDMI 連接的 1600×900 分辨率的 19 英寸顯示器。
在做出這些選擇之後,我最終會得到一個看起來像這樣的多面 URL:
https://example.com/monitors/filters?size=19inch&resolution=1600x900pixel&connectivity=hdmi
這是我一直在使用的同一監視器頁面的縮小版本。 這個頁面沒有不同的內容,只是少了一些。
該頁面也將與訪問者可以創建的其他縮小版本的頁面非常相似,如下所示:
https://example.com/monitors/filters?size=19inch,22inch&resolution=1600x900pixel&connectivity=hdmi,wga
而且,根據您的內容管理系統 (CMS) 和您的開發人員,甚至可能存在相同 URL 的不同組合——本質上,兩個頁面都存在且完全相同,例如:
https://example.com/monitors/filters?size=19inch&connectivity=hdmi
&
https://example.com/monitors/filters?size=19inch&connectivity=hdmi
上面兩個頁面之間的唯一區別是,分面以不同的順序列出,具體取決於訪問者單擊過濾器的順序。
知道了這一點,一個擁有 200,000 個產品頁面的網站最終可能擁有超過 5 億個頁面,這可能也就不足為奇了。
儘管用戶能夠自定義他們的搜索並根據他們的需要找到最好的產品,但搜索引擎肯定會難以確定您希望他們索引哪些頁面。
知道 Google 沒有抓取您的普通企業網站上的一半頁面,您可能想知道,他們缺少哪一半?

他們是否錯過了您的低價值重複頁面? 或者他們是否錯過了您關鍵的、推動收入的產品頁面?
我們還知道,由於被抓取頁面的比例較低,網站產生自然搜索流量的頁面較少,而且隨著網站規模的增加,這些數字只會變得更糟。

舉個例子——我們不能讓機器人來猜測。

我如何知道 Google 是否找到了我的重要頁面?
要查看像 Google 這樣的搜索引擎機器人是否正在查找您的重要頁面,或者是否在重複的方面頁面上浪費時間,您可以查看您的服務器日誌文件。

要查看 Google 已將您的哪些頁面編入索引,您可以在 Google Search Console (GSC) 中抽查 URL,或使用 Botify 查看已編入索引的所有分面頁面。

要查看其中哪些頁面獲得了點擊和流量,您可以使用 Google 或 Adobe Analytics、GSC 進行抽查或 Botify(通過我們的 Analytics 和 GSC 集成)。

理想情況下,Googlebot 只會對您的主要、有價值的頁面進行抓取、索引、排名和為您的網站帶來流量。 您會希望 Googlebot 遠離由構面和過濾器創建的重複頁面,以免損害高價值頁面的性能。
如何審核您的 SEO 多面導航
從理論上理解多面導航 SEO 問題是一回事。 下一個障礙是了解分面導航如何影響我們自己的網站。
如果您想審核您的網站是否存在多面導航 SEO 問題,我們建議您執行以下步驟:
1. 熟悉構面在您的網站上的工作方式
為了診斷分面搜索問題,您需要充分了解您的網站如何使用分面導航。
要弄清楚這一點,請提出以下問題:
- 構面僅存在於我的類別頁面上,還是我們在網站的其他部分(例如博客)也使用構面?
- 是否有分層順序如何將構面附加到您的 URL? (例如,品牌方面總是第一,定價方面總是第二)
- 您可以添加多少方面是否有限制,或者是否可以無限組合? (例如,用戶生成的方面,在站點搜索欄中輸入的任何內容都會創建一個新方面)
在 Botify 中,您可以使用高級細分或自定義提取來量化和可視化您網站的分面導航。 在下面的示例中,我們正在查看一個 2000 萬頁的網站,其中包含超過 1900 萬個分面頁面——其中超過 80% 的頁面添加了 3 個以上的分面。
通過了解您網站的分面導航,您將更好地了解它可能導致的 SEO 問題的範圍。
2. 評估分面頁面的流量
一旦您了解了您的網站上有多少和什麼樣的方面,您就可以使用您的分析來確定這些頁面中的任何一個是否有價值 - 換句話說,哪些方面的頁面正在為您的網站帶來自然搜索流量?
通過在 Botify 中按方面查看活動頁面,您可以輕鬆地看到這一點。 例如,在這個網站上,我們可以看到它的大部分頁面(具有 3 個方面的 URL)都沒有增加流量。 這是一個巨大的抓取預算風險,這導致我們進入下一步。

3. 識別分面頁面上的抓取浪費
正如我們剛剛看到的,一些分面頁面可以從自然搜索中獲得流量。 但是,其他分面頁面可能會浪費您的抓取預算。 你怎麼知道哪個是哪個?
一個很好的起點是將“Google 抓取”(機器人)與“Google 訪問”(用戶)進行比較。
在下面的示例中,具有 3 個以上構面的網址佔據了抓取預算的很大一部分(它們從 Googlebot 獲得的點擊次數比網站上的任何其他網址都多)。 但是,這些頁面從 Google Organic 產生的訪問者很少。
如果 Googlebot 大量抓取某些網頁,但這些網頁並沒有帶來流量,那麼這些網頁可能會浪費您的抓取預算。
4. 確定分面頁面的搜索需求
一旦您了解了您網站上發生的事情,就該在場外查看搜索需求了。 換句話說,我們正在創建的頁面是否有足夠的搜索需求?
如果您的分面導航創建的頁面需求低或沒有需求(例如,很少有人在搜索“中號皮夾克”),您可能需要考慮將其排除在索引之外。 另一方面,如果由分面導航創建的頁面需求量很大(例如,很多人搜索“100 美元以下的皮夾克”),那麼確保這些頁面可索引是個好主意。

5. 檢查您的庫存,了解您可以在哪里為用戶提供更多結果
最後,使用您的庫存(產品或內容)來了解您可以在哪里為用戶提供更多結果。
在 Botify 中,您可以使用自定義提取來確定您在每個類別頁面上擁有的產品數量。 然後,您可以優先考慮具有最佳產品的 URL,以推動更多流量和轉化。
我應該如何處理我的分面導航頁面?
了解如何處理分面導航頁面很複雜,因此我們根據 Aleyda 在索引分面頁面上的爬行星期一劇集創建了我們的決策圖版本,以幫助您使用元標記引導搜索機器人。

按照此圖表,您最終會得到三組分面頁面:
- 索引(應該總是有一個自引用的規範標籤,不應該被 robots.txt 阻止,並且應該有指向它的有價值的內部鏈接)
- 不要索引(應該包含一個 noindex 標籤)
- 塊爬取(不應該被 bot 訪問,這可以通過 robots.txt、GSC 中的參數處理、JavaScript 和 nofollow 鏈接的組合來實現)
將分面導航頁面分類到這些組後,您將更清楚地了解需要採取的操作。
要深入了解現實世界的多面搜索示例,請查看“大規模 SEO:大型電子商務網站的不同之處”。 在其中,Barnes & Noble SEO 和個性化經理 Jessica Flareau 解釋了多面導航對她公司的 SEO 戰略的重要性,並在觀眾問答期間分享了一些執行策略。
雖然沒有萬能的解決方案來處理分面導航(這取決於許多因素,例如您的 CMS 和您可以獲得的開發資源),但我們將引導您了解一些可用於在本文的第二部分中,您的分面導航頁面的 index、noindex 或塊爬網,敬請期待!
